Frequently Asked Questions

How do I clean my speakers?

Use a dust free cloth (such as a micro fiber cloth) or a soft brush to remove dust from your speakers. Do not spray any kind of cleaning agent on or in close proximity to the drivers..

Could you suggest a list of suitable elec- tronics and cables ideal for MartinLogan speakers?

We have no favorites and use electronics and cables quite interchangeably. We would suggest listening to a number of brands—and above all else—trust your ears. Dealers are always the best source for information when purchasing additional audio equipment.

Is there likely to be any interaction between my speakers and the televi- sion in my A/V system?

Yes. These speakers are not shielded and should be kept at least 2 feet away from a CRT television.

Will exposure to sunlight affect the life or performance of my speakers?

We recommend against placing any loudspeaker in direct sunlight. Ultraviolet (UV) rays from the sun can cause deterioration of cabinet, speaker cones, etc. Small exposures to UV will not cause a prob- lem. Filtering of UV rays through glass will greatly reduce the negative effects.

Should I use a 4, 6, or 8 Ohm rated amplifier with my speakers?

All of our Motion series speakers are compatible with 4, 6 or 8 Ohm output audio amplifiers and receivers. Many of the most popular brands of AV receivers and amplifiers with 4, 6 and 8 Ohm out- put ratings have been thoroughly tested with all of our Motion series products and we have found no compatibility issues except under extreme listening conditions. For the best performance and sonic purity when using our Motion series products use of an amplifier or AV receiver with either a 4 or 6 Ohm output is recommended!

Troubleshooting

No Output

Check that all system components are turned on and source material is playing.

Check speaker wires and connections.

Check all interconnecting cables.

If you are unable to resolve your problem, please contact your dealer or MartinLogan cus- tomer service (see below).
